Understanding the Current Business Landscape
Before diving into specific strategies, it’s essential to grasp the current business environment. The aftermath of the pandemic has reshaped consumer behavior, with a significant shift towards online shopping and digital interactions. Businesses must adapt to these changes to remain relevant.
Key Trends Influencing Business Growth
Digital Transformation: Companies are increasingly investing in technology to enhance customer experiences and streamline operations.
Sustainability: Consumers are more conscious of their purchasing decisions, favoring brands that prioritize sustainability.
Remote Work: The rise of remote work has changed how businesses operate, necessitating new management and communication strategies.
Strategy 1: Embrace Digital Transformation
Digital transformation is no longer optional; it’s a critical component of growth. Businesses that leverage technology can improve efficiency, enhance customer experiences, and gain a competitive edge.
Implementing Effective Digital Tools
Customer Relationship Management (CRM): Tools like Salesforce or HubSpot can help manage customer interactions and data, leading to better service and increased sales.
E-commerce Platforms: Investing in robust e-commerce solutions can expand your market reach and improve sales.
Data Analytics: Utilizing data analytics tools can provide insights into customer behavior, helping tailor marketing strategies effectively.
Case Study: A Retail Success Story
Consider a local retail store that transitioned to an online platform during the pandemic. By implementing an e-commerce solution and utilizing social media for marketing, they saw a 150% increase in sales within six months. This example illustrates the power of digital transformation in driving growth.
Strategy 2: Focus on Customer Experience
In today’s market, customer experience is paramount. Businesses that prioritize customer satisfaction are more likely to retain clients and attract new ones.
Enhancing Customer Interactions
Personalization: Tailor your offerings based on customer preferences. Use data to create personalized marketing campaigns that resonate with your audience.
Feedback Mechanisms: Implement systems for gathering customer feedback. This can include surveys, reviews, and direct communication channels.
Customer Support: Invest in training your support team to provide exceptional service. Quick and effective responses can significantly enhance customer loyalty.
Example: A Restaurant’s Approach
A local restaurant implemented a loyalty program that rewarded customers for their repeat visits. By personalizing offers based on previous orders, they increased customer retention by 30%. This demonstrates how focusing on customer experience can lead to tangible growth.
Strategy 3: Leverage Social Responsibility
Consumers today are more inclined to support businesses that demonstrate social responsibility. By aligning your brand with meaningful causes, you can enhance your reputation and attract a loyal customer base.
Building a Socially Responsible Brand
Community Engagement: Participate in local events or sponsor community initiatives. This builds goodwill and strengthens your brand image.
Sustainable Practices: Implement eco-friendly practices in your operations. This can include reducing waste, sourcing sustainable materials, or supporting fair trade.
Transparency: Be open about your business practices and the impact you have on the community and environment.
Case Study: A Clothing Brand’s Commitment
A clothing brand that committed to using sustainable materials and donating a portion of profits to environmental causes saw a significant increase in brand loyalty. Customers appreciated their transparency and commitment to social responsibility, leading to a 40% increase in sales.
Strategy 4: Invest in Employee Development
Your employees are your greatest asset. Investing in their development not only boosts morale but also enhances productivity and innovation.
Creating a Culture of Learning
Training Programs: Offer regular training sessions to help employees develop new skills relevant to their roles.
Career Advancement Opportunities: Provide clear pathways for career growth within the company. This encourages employees to invest in their roles.
Feedback and Recognition: Foster an environment where feedback is encouraged, and achievements are recognized. This can lead to higher job satisfaction and retention rates.
Example: A Tech Company’s Initiative
A tech company that implemented a mentorship program saw a 25% increase in employee satisfaction. By investing in their employees’ growth, they not only improved morale but also enhanced their overall productivity.
Strategy 5: Expand Your Market Reach
Exploring new markets can provide significant growth opportunities. Whether through geographical expansion or targeting new customer segments, diversifying your market can lead to increased revenue.
Strategies for Market Expansion
Market Research: Conduct thorough research to identify potential markets. Understand the needs and preferences of your target audience in these areas.
Partnerships: Collaborate with local businesses or influencers to gain insights and establish a presence in new markets.
Adaptation: Be willing to adapt your products or services to meet the specific needs of new markets.
Case Study: A Beverage Company’s Expansion
A beverage company that expanded its product line to include health-focused drinks saw a 60% increase in sales. By understanding market trends and consumer preferences, they successfully tapped into a growing segment.
